#054d67 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#054d67 is composed of 2% red, 30.2%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.1% cyan, 25.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 195.9 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 21.2%. #054d67 color hex could be obtained by blending #0a9ace with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#054d67

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000709 is the darkest color, while #f6fc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#054d67

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#333839 is the less saturated color, while #014f6b is the most saturated one.
